Orville Smoke

July 12, 1947 — October 5, 2021

~ Tocan Sneya Had Najee ~

“He Who Stands Making a Noise”

Chief Orville Charles Smoke, lifelong resident of Dakota Plains, passed away peacefully in his home surrounded by loved ones on October 5th , 2021at the age of 74 years.

Orville will be lovingly remembered by his brothers Ronald Smoke Sr. and Leslie Smoke; his children Arden (Sherry), Donny (Joan) and Evangeline (Jason); wife Rosalind and her sons Peter Sky and Cole Merrick; grandchildren Ashley (Ryan), Chandelle, Ethan, Melora (Jeff), Keaton (Jordan), Jaytey, Sophia and Deshawn; great-grandchildren Riley and Rowan.

He was predeceased by his parents Tiyo and Chaske Smoke, sister Rowena McIvor and brothers Raymond, Ernie, Stuart, Arnett, Gordon and  Laurence Smoke.

Orville was born in Portage la Prairie on July 12th, 1947. He attended Portage la Prairie Residential School and vocational college in Winnipeg. Orville began working for the community of Dakota Plains in 1968, becoming Chief in 1994 with the blessing of the community following the passing of his brother Ernie. A jack of all trades, Orville was a skilled mechanic, plumber, welder, preacher, hunter, poet and artist. He enjoyed playing and watching pool, baseball, hockey and listening to good music. He was the most kindhearted and caring man, always willing to lend a helping hand and listening ear to anyone who was in need. He will be deeply missed by his friends, family and all who knew them.
